Vitajte na [www.pocitac.win] Pripojiť k domovskej stránke Obľúbené stránky
Vytvorte novú databázu . Mnoho poskytovateľov hostingu umožňujú svojim užívateľom vytvoriť novú databázu MySQL pomocou ovládacieho cPanel MySQL databázy panel . Otvorte MySQL cPanel , kliknite na tlačidlo Vytvoriť databázu a zadajte názov novej databázy . Môžete tiež zvoliť pridať viac užívateľov do databázy s MySQL cPanel .
2
Začať novú tabuľku a pripojiť nové primárne pole kľúča auto - increment . Primárne pole • Automatické zvyšovanie automaticky poskytne jedinečný číselný identifikátor pre každého nového dátového súboru umiestneného do tejto tabuľky databázy . Unikátny ID môže byť použitá tak , aby zodpovedala dátový záznam k záznamom v iných databázach . Tým sa vytvorí vzťah medzi dvoma databázami . Zoberme si tento príklad PHP kód . Nová databáza tabuľku s názvom NewTable bol vytvorený pomocou MySQL príkazu Vytvoriť tabuľku . Tabuľka bola priradená primárny kľúč pole s názvom ID . PHP funkcia mysql_query vykoná príkaz
$ sql = ' CREATE TABLE ` yourDatabase ` NewTable ` ( ` id ` INT ( 10 ) NOT NULL AUTO_INCREMENT PRIMARY KEY ) ENGINE = MyISAM . " ; .
mysql_query ( $ sql ) or die ( "
Chyba , vytvorenie novej databázy zlyhalo < /p > ' ) ;
3
Vytvorte pole časovej pečiatky . Časové pečiatky pole obsahuje dôležitú súčasť štruktúry záznamu . To vám umožní administrovať dáta v závislosti na tom , kedy bol súbor dát vytvoril . Môžete si zvoliť automatické nastavenie každej inštancie pečiatka pole času sa zhoduje so záznamom v dátum vytvorenia . V nasledujúcom príklade , MySQL Alter Table príkaz zmení tabuľku pridať nové pole časovej pečiatky . Obsah tohto poľa časovej pečiatky bude predvolený časovú pečiatku v čase vytvorenia záznamu v
$ sql = ' ALTER TABLE ` NewTable ` ADD ` timestamp ` TIMESTAMP NOT NULL DEFAULT CURRENT_TIMESTAMP " ; .
mysql_query ( $ sql ) or die ( "
Chyba , váš pokus o zmenu zlyhalo < /p > ' ) ;
4
definovať čiastkové polia . Môžete zadať ďalšie pole podľa potreby . Nasledujúci kód bude opäť pomocou príkazu ALTER TABLE vytvoriť ďalšie štruktúru záznamu , ktorý obsahuje meno , e - mail , PhoneNumber a polia adresy. Všimnite si , že dĺžka každého poľa bola obmedzená na iba 100 znakov . Táto technika odreže nadmerné vstup dát do každej konštrukcie .
$ Sql = ' ALTER TABLE ` NewTable ` ADD ` názov ` VARCHAR ( 100 ) NOT NULL , ADD ` e ` VARCHAR ( 100 ) NOT NULL , ADD ` PhoneNumber ` VARCHAR ( 100 ) NOT NULL , ADD ` adresa ` VARCHAR ( 100 ) NOT NULL ; "
mysql_query ( $ sql ) or die ( "
Chyba , váš pokus o zmenu zlyhal < ! /p > ' ) ;